The Tell-Tale Heart Vocabulary Words
ACUTE
(adj.) keen, shart
PROFOUND
(adj.) of the greatest intensity
SINGULARLY
(adv) especially, exceptionally
VEHEMENTLY
(adv) fiercely, violently
DERISION
(n) , ridicule, mockery
CREVICE
(n) a long narrow opening, crack
TATOO
(n) continuous drumming, military term
DISSIMILATION
(n) disguise
SUPPOSITIONS
(n) educated guesses, assumptions that are believed to be true
SCANTLINGS
(n) small beams of wood
SAGACITY
(n) wisdom., ability to make good judgments
AUDACITY
(n), excessive boldness, rashness, daring
DEPUTED
(v) delegated; to appoint as a representative
STIFLED
(v) held back or stopped
WANED
(v) lesssened, diminished
VEXED
(v) troubled, bothered
FLUENTLY
easily and rapidly, as in speaking or writing
GESTICULATIONS
energetic hand or arm movements
HYPOCRITICAL
pretending to be virtuous; deceiving
